Defer creation of default_config_
(This is a merge of http://go/wvgerrit/152969.) C++ makes absolutely no guarantees about the order of initialization of global variables in different compilation units. The class-scope static WvCdmTestBase::default_config_ in test_base.cpp invokes the ConfigTestEnv constructor on creation, which depends on the prior initialization of several file-scope static variables in config_test_env.cpp. Since those are different compilation units, there is no guarantee that they will initialize in the correct order to avoid referencing uninitialized memory. This is one of the reasons Google Style really encourages people not to have global-scope variables with complex types. As it happens, on all our internal platforms, these files get linked in such a way that the variables get initialized in the right order and there is no crash. But that's not guaranteed, and some partners have reported crashes here. In at least one case, the "right" linker order was platform-dependent, and the partner ended up having to maintain separate linker orders for separate platforms. This patch defers default_config_ initialization until WvCdmTestBase::Initialize() is called. By that time, all static variables will be initialized, so it will be safe to reference them.
